Centre of Advanced Studies in Marine Biology: The Centre of Advanced Study (CAS) in Marine Biology is a reputed Marine Institute in India actively engaged in teaching, research, and extension activities in Marine Sciences, the Centre has made rapid strides in various facets of Marine Science. Established in 1957 and recognized by the UGC in 1963, the Centre offers a prime location with easy access to different biotopes such as estuary, mangrove, backwaters, and coastal waters.
